Frequently Asked Questions

How do I start an integration between Captions and HL Pro Tools?

To start, connect both your Captions and HL Pro Tools accounts to viaSocket. Once connected, you can set up a workflow where an event in Captions triggers actions in HL Pro Tools (or vice versa).

Can we customize how data from Captions is recorded in HL Pro Tools?

Absolutely. You can customize how Captions data is recorded in HL Pro Tools. This includes choosing which data fields go into which fields of HL Pro Tools, setting up custom formats, and filtering out unwanted information.

How often does the data sync between Captions and HL Pro Tools?

The data sync between Captions and HL Pro Tools typically happens in real-time through instant triggers. And a maximum of 15 minutes in case of a scheduled trigger.

Can I filter or transform data before sending it from Captions to HL Pro Tools?

Yes, viaSocket allows you to add custom logic or use built-in filters to modify data according to your needs.

Is it possible to add conditions to the integration between Captions and HL Pro Tools?

Yes, you can set conditional logic to control the flow of data between Captions and HL Pro Tools. For instance, you can specify that data should only be sent if certain conditions are met, or you can create if/else statements to manage different outcomes.
